Philly.com Sports: With the Philadelphia Eagles season continuing in a downward spiral, the team dismissed another employee. This time, public relations spokesperson Rob Zeiger was relieved of his duties on Wednesday.

The corporate PR post with the Eagles has a troubled history, with several people coming and going over the last half-decade. The team has an entire department devoted to football media services, separate from the corporate spokesman. Traditionally, the corporate spokesman was a media liasion for former team president Joe Banner, who hired Zeiger away from the Amway Corporation in 2011.
